Notes:
Second valve case has “M” for medium bore and stamped with depiction of eagle with lyre, “TRADEMARK,” and “PAT. APRIL / 2.1907”.
Crosshatch knurling on valve caps suggests that these were from Buescher during the Conn factory rebuild after their 1910 fire. Manufacturers often helped each other out with parts.
Mother-of-pearl valve caps
